Investigación

Publicación (Conferencias y Seminarios)

A Linux Implementation of the Energy-based Fair Queuing Algorithm on an ARM-based Embedded System

Juárez Martínez, Eduardo; Garrido González, Matías; Pescador del Oso, Fernando
Resumen:
In this paper, an implementation of the energy-based fair queuing (EFQ) scheduling algorithm based on Linux is presented. EFQ is an extended application of the fair queuing algorithm in the domain of energy management for achieving proportional energy use among user applications. The Linux scheduling structure has been effectively utilized to ease the EFQ implementation and reduce the scheduling overhead. A test-bench based on the POSIX threads and newly added system calls has been developed to assess the EFQ scheduler on an ARM-based platform. Experiment results show that EFQ is more effective than the Linux scheduler in managing energy and maximizing the user experience of battery-limited mobile systems.
Año:
2014
Tipo de publicación:
Conferencias y Seminarios
Dirección:
Las Vegas, NV
Organización:
2014 IEEE INTERNATIONAL CONFERENCE ON CONSUMER ELECTRONICS (ICCE)
Mes:
Enero
ISBN:
978-1-4799-1291-9
ISSN:
2158-3994
Hits: 5775